Evolution
|
change in a species over time; process of biological change by which descendants come to differ from their ancestors
|
|
Natural selection
|
mechanism by which individuals that have inherited beneficial adaptations produce more offspring on average than do other individuals
|
|
Charles Darwin
|
published-on the Origin of the Species by Means of Natural Selection
|
|
Fitness
|
measure of an organisms ability to survive and produce offspring relative to other members of a population
|
|
Inheritability
|
ability of a trait to be passed from one generation to the next
|
|
Artificial Selection
|
process by which humans modify a species by breeding it for certain traits
|
|
Adaptation
|
inherited trait that is selected for over time because it allows organisms to better survive in their environment
|
|
Fossil record
|
artifacts of living things and their placement within earth's rock strata
